Course Overview

Would you like to improve your research, communication, speaking, and presentation skills while learning to persuade in one action-packed course? Each day students will research a debate topic. They will then compose argumentative cases and deliver to judges throughout the course. After each debate round, students will receive instructor feedback as well as deliver/receive peer. If desired, it may be possible to culminate the course in an in-class debate tournament. This class will sharpen key skills that will boost your speaking confidence and enhance your ability to organize and express ideas clearly.

Course Structure


There are nine 3-hour class sessions over the two-week course. During week one, students have class from 9am-12pm, Monday - Friday. During week two, students have class from 9am-12pm Monday through Thursday. Wednesday afternoons are dedicated to additional academic time (excursions, speakers).
